​Bloodstock
festival has reveal another six bands joining the event, hailing from not just the UK, but also Spain, Finland, and Egypt. Additionally, the annual Metal 2 The Masses finals, which seek out the best new metal talent across the country and beyond, kick off this coming weekend.  Headlined by Sabaton, Parkway Drive and Scorpions, BOA 2019 takes place at Catton Park, Derbyshire from 8th - 11th August. 

Appearing on the Sophie Lancaster stage on Sunday are Anglo-Finnish tech progsters Wheel. Expect to hear some tracks from their recently released debut album ‘Moving Backwards’, including their latest single ‘Where The Pieces Lie’. 

Joining them are Preston old school thrashers Solitary, recently reunited with guitarist Gaz Harrop after an eighteen year gap and celebrating their 25th anniversary in 2019. 

Spanish thrash beasts Vioblast  are set to melt faces on Sunday’s Sophie stage, shredding tracks from latest album ‘Theater Of Despair’.

Adding to Sunday’s Sophie mayhem are Egyptian blackened death metal outfit, Crescent, who released latest album ‘The Order Of Amenti’ via Listenable Records.

Finnish metal squad, Blood Red Hourglass also grab a Sunday slot on the Sophie stage. The band are readying the release of their 4th studio album, ‘Godsend’ for 31st May. 

Finally, joining the Sophie Lancaster stage bill on Saturday are British prog instrumentalists, The Parallex Method. The band have previously graced the stage at  ​Bloodstock, as well as held slots at had Download and Hard Rock Hell.

Bloodstock 2019  is set to feature Anthrax, Dimmu Borgir, Children of Bodom, Code Orange, Soilwork, Cradle of Filth, Metal Church, Soulfly, Death Angel, Dee Snider, Queensryche, and many more. ​
